How do i move music from my doc.s or from amazon cloud player into itunes?

Hi,  how do i move music from my 'music' files in doc.s or from amazon cloud player to itunes?

Use Amazon's download utility to download the content on your computer and add it into iTunes.

  • How do I move music from one apple ID to another

    How do I move music from one apple ID to another?

    If you want to change your iCloud ID to another existing ID you'll have to delete the account, create a new account with the other ID, and migrate your data (including the calendar) to the new account.  To do this, first go to Settings>iCloud on your iPad and turn all data you are syncing with iCloud (contacts, calendars, etc.) to Off.  When prompted choose to keep the data on your iPad.  After everything is turned off, scroll to the bottom and tap Delete Account.  (Note, this will delete the account from your iPad but not from iCloud.  The account will remain in iCloud if anyone else chooses to remain signed into it an continue to use it.)  Next, set up the new iCloud account using your new ID, then turn syncing for your data (contacts, etc.) back to On.*  When prompted, choose Merge.  This will upload the data to your new account.
    * If you only want to upload the calendar, only turn Calendar to On; but I'm assuming you will be the owner and want this to be your iCloud account on your iPad with all your data, and then your can share the calendar with others and administrate it.

  • How do I move music from desktop to iTunes on the same computer?

    I have new music on my Macbook desktop. I want to move it into iTunes.  This was easy with iTunes 10, but it doesn't work with iTunes 11. So how can I manage new music that isn't purchased throught the iTunes store? How can I move music into iTunes?
    I'd really like to go back to iTunes 10 since it was user-friendly and iTunes 11 is extremely iTunes friendly; os if you know how to do that I'd appreciate it greatly.  Or I'd appreciate learnig about another music management system - other than iTunes since iTunes 10 isn't available any more.

    =Downgrading from iTunes 11 to iTunes 10.7=
    You may be able to go back with Time Machine but this may involve restoring other items too (https://discussions.apple.com/message/20441404).  Alternatively:
    Back up your computer first, in case the unexpected happens.
    Quit iTunes.
    Get iTunes 10.7 from http://support.apple.com/kb/DL1576 or the direct download link at:  http://appldnld.apple.com/iTunes10/041-7195.20120912.d3uzQ/iTunes10.7.dmg
    Do a few preparatory steps by making sure all iTunes components are not running and cleaning old files.   See https://discussions.apple.com/message/20475394.  Do steps 3 and 4.  Steps 6-8 may be also useful but I don't know if they are essential.  Some of the other steps are not necessary, duplicate steps listed later in my post or are perhaps even unhelpful in the process.
    Replace the iTunes 11 application with iTunes 10.7.  Simply dragging the application to the trash may not work. Lion (OSX 10.7) and newer systems have iTunes integrated into the operating system and deleting is a bit more involved.  Two ways to do this are:
    1.  Use the shareware Pacifist utility (http://www.charlessoft.com/) to install iTunes 10.7 including all associated system files. Details at http://forums.macrumors.com/showpost.php?p=16400819&postcount=6
    2. Check this reference on how to delete the iTunes application itself:
        Delete iTunes in Mac OS X 10.7 Lion - http://osxdaily.com/2011/09/13/delete-itunes-in-mac-os-x-10-7-lion/
        After deleting the application there may be other files that need downgrading too. See the note about error -42408 at the end of this post. You may want to tuck these away somewhere safe until you have completed the installation of iTunes 10.7.  I have not tested this but ideally if newer versions are not found then the installer will put in the old versions. This may include these files in /System/Library/PrivateFrameworks/ which apparently get updated by iTunes 11:
    AirTrafficHost.framework
    CoreFP.framework
    DeviceLink.framework
    iTunesAccess.framework
    MobileDevice.framework
    After doing one of the two procedures above you will have to rescue the most recent old iTunes library from your iTunes > Previous Libraries folder. Rename it "iTunes Library.itl"  and replace the existing one in the iTunes folder. A newer version of iTunes irreversibly updates your library file so you have to replace it with the old one or you will get an error message. Note, this will revert your library to the version at the time of the upgrade and you will have to update any changes made since.  See:
    https://discussions.apple.com/message/20401436 - turingtest2 11/2012 post on rebuilding empty/corrupt library from previous iTunes library file after upgrade/crash.
    iTunes: How to re-create your iTunes library and playlists - http://support.apple.com/kb/ht1451

  • How can I move music from a hard drive to iphone

    How can I move music from a hard drive to iphone?

    Import it into an iTunes library and then sync the iPhone with that library. If desired, launch iTunes with the Shift key held down and create or choose an iTunes library on that drive.

  • How do you move music from iTunes on a pc to ipad2

    How do you move music from iTunes on a pc to an ipad2?

    Connect your iPad to your computer and select it on the left-hand side of your computer's iTunes under 'Devices'. On the right-hand side there should then be a series of tabs, one of which is Music - select that and you should be able to select which of your computer's iTunes music to sync to the Music app on the iPad, and then sync/apply that selection.
    This page refers specifically to the iPod and iPhone, but the principle is the same for the iPad : http://support.apple.com/kb/HT1351

  • HT1473 How do you move music from itunes on a windows computer to an iPhone 5,  Music from my existing collection?

    How do you move music from itunes in a XP computer to an iPhone 5?

    You copy the content of your iTunes Library to the iPhone by connecting to the iPhone to your computer, using the USB lead that came wiht the phone, and allowing iTunes and the iPhone to Sync with one another.
    This will leave the content in your iTunes Library. An iPhone (or iPod) is not desinged to be the only location for your music (or other content). The idea is that the iPhone (or iPod) has a copy of the Library.

  • How do I move music from my iTunes library to my iPhone?

    iTunes 12 is certainly a different UI from before.  Previously, there was an icon of my plugged-in iPhone in the upper right corner of the UI to which I could drag items I wanted to transfer to my phone - movies, music, etc.
    That's gone.  I'm seeing my iTunes library, and the iTunes store, but no references at all to my iPhone 6 that's plugged in.
    So, how do I now transfer items from my iTunes library to my iPhone???

    You can connect your iPhone (wired) to you Mac and in iTunes an iPhone-icon will appear right next to the three dot in the white top bar. It will also appear in the sidebar you can open by clicking on the playlistsbutton right next to My Music. If you click on your iPhone in the sidebar all folders on the iPhone will be unfolded and you can drag and drop music from you library to you iPhone (as shown in the screenshot below).
    If you click on the iPhone icon in the white bar, you get the screens to manage the content of you iPhone and synchronize.
    PS: the iPhone should appear wireless as well, but does not most of the time. This is a bug. I expect it to be solved in the next update. Until then we must work wired.
